Procedures for manipulating Name-Number Tables

DUMPNNT lists the entries that are in use CLEARNNT sets a NNT to zero. It can (will) be re-created automatically at the next CCK STATUSNNT analyses a NNT and computes a histogram of the path lengths to reach each name OPTNNT saves the current NNT in a file N#NTf where f is the fsys number. Re-orders the entries in an optimum way RESTORENNT returns the contents N#NTf to the NNT
